GMB Law Firms

There is really an abundance of benefits of having a gmb for law firms page set up and optimised. Here are some of the main ones that attract consumers when searching for a service online :

  • A photo of their business can be include, which helps potential customers familiarise themselves with what they look like and what their business is about before meeting them.
  • It helps to build the search engine rankings of your website, as having a presence on Google My Business often provides links directly back to your firm’s website. This not only improves the SEO of your site but also makes sure that even more traffic comes straight through to you from search engines if they are looking for law firms in your area specifically.
  • The page can include up-to-date information regarding opening hours, contact numbers, map location etc. – making it far more likely that you will give off an image of being professional and organised to anyone reading this information online.
  • You can provide direct links so customers can book or make enquiries with very little effort, which means they are far more likely to take the action you want.
  • You can even respond directly to reviews of your firm on GMB, allowing you to interact with customers in a way that is not possible anywhere else. Although this might be seen by some as an unnecessary risk if negative feedback has been posted, I view it only as an opportunity to put people’s opinions right and prove your reliability – or just help them see things from another perspective!

On the other side of the coin, there are many cons regarding having no Google My Business page present for your law business too:-

  • Customers will not get enough information about who you are and what you do, so they cant make an informed decision about whether or not to give you a call.
  • Your website will receive a lower rank on Google, meaning it will be harder for people to find your law firm online.
  • The first page of your local ‘Google Maps’ results will very often have all the best lawyers listed in that area, and if they do not, then at least half of them will normally show up there (i.e., competing firms such as yourself). If this is the case, you can expect that most of your business from search engines like Google comes from these listings – which means that having no presence here leaves revenue on the table.
  • You run the risk of clients finding out about other law firms before hearing back from you, possibly resulting in lost sales and damaged reputation.
